The uPVC Sash window frame is composed of three major components. The top and bottom of the frame are the sill and head, while the side jambs comprise of two vertical pieces on each side. The sash forms the part of the window that houses the glazing. Unlike timber sash windows, uPVC sash windows use a patented counterbalance system instead of cords and weights.
